Establish Albumin-creatinine Ratio Reference Value of Adults in the Rural Area of Hebei Province
详细信息    查看全文
文摘
To establish albumin-creatinine ratio (ACR) reference value of the rural population in Hebei province.

Methods

This study enrolled 5154 participants. By excluding subjects with hypertension, diabetes, dyslipidemia, cardiovascular and cerebrovascular diseases, kidney diseases, and overweight condition, as well as those with an estimated glomerular filtration rate (eGFR) < 60 ml/(min·1.73 m2), apparently healthy subjects (1168) were selected. Urine albumin was measured by using the immunoturbidimetic method, serum creatinine was measured by using Jaffe's kinetic method on a morning spot-urine sample, and ACR was calculated. The 95th percentile of ACR in the healthy subjects was used as the normal upper limit.

Results

The normal upper limit of ACR was 28.71 mg/g (3.25 mg/mmol) for males and 31.85 mg/g (3.60 mg/mmol) for females. Based on this ACR reference value, the age-gender standardized prevalence of albuminuria in the rural areas of Hebei province was 12.9%.

Conclusion

The ACR reference value in the rural of Hebei province is higher than that of the Western population.
